Romans 12:3 - "Do not think of yourself more highly than you ought."

We should not think too highly of ourselves, and we should not think that others are inferior. We should not despise and reject other members of the Body. Those who think highly of themselves and despise other members will end up in trouble sooner or later. In the Body of Christ everyone is a member and nothing more than a member. Hence, no member can live without the other members, much less despise them.
